Power is not revealed by striking hard or often, but by striking true.
Honore De Balzac
ShareWTF𝕏

Interpretation

What this quote means

True power lies in the accuracy and effectiveness of one's actions rather than their intensity or frequency.

This quote by Honore De Balzac suggests that the essence of true power is not measured by how aggressively one acts but by the precision and correctness of those actions. It emphasizes that impactful results are achieved through thoughtful and deliberate choices instead of mere force or repetition, encouraging individuals to focus on quality over quantity in their efforts.
